cpuidle, OMAP3: Push RCU-idle into omap_sram_idle()
OMAP3 uses full SoC suspend modes as idle states, as such it needs the whole power-domain and clock-domain code from the idle path. All that code is not suitable to run with RCU disabled, as such push RCU-idle deeper still.
